About this experience

Central Asian Expedition led by American researcher and explorer Roy Chapman Andrews brought home the first ever recorded dinosaur eggs found from Desert of Mongolia. Imagine yourself eye witnessing the great Flaming Cliffs where all the fossils and eggs were discovered while enjoying the dusk. Wonders of Gobi will continue with long stretches of Khongor sand dunes which lie within Gobi Gurvan Saikhan National Park. The Naadam festival is the biggest yet most jubilant national celebration for Mongolians. The Festival consists of three main games referred as “Three Manly Sports” such as traditional wrestling, horse racing and archery. In the aisles of the Central Stadium, both archery and the fourth Naadam game- ankle bone shooting will surely capture your interest.
